RF Ceramic Wire Wound Chip Inductor, General Grade
30nH, 400mA, 0402 RF Ceramic Wire Wound Chip Inductor SWI CT series with minimum tolerance 2% available, advance in higher self resonate frequency (SRF), high Q factor, and is widely used in the co mmunication applications such as cellular phones, cable modem, ADSL, repeaters, Bluetooth, and other electronic devices.
Product Features
- Higher Self Resonate Frequency (SRF)
- High Q factor
- Tight tolerance ± 0.2nH and 2% available
- Operating temp.: -40°C ~ +125°C (including self-temperature rise)

| Product Category | RF Inductor - Ceramic Wire Wound Chip Inductor | Inductance (µH) | 0.03 |
| Part Number | SWI0402CT30N | Tolerance | ±2% |
| Grade | General | RDC (Ω) | 0.3 |
| Length (mm) | 1 | IDC (A) | 0.4 |
| Width (mm) | 0.55 | Operating temp.°C (LOW) | -40 |
| Height (mm) | 0.5 | Operating temp.°C (HIGH) | 125 |
